A highly efficient carbon-sulfur bond formation reaction via microwave-assisted nucleophilic substitution of thiols to polychloroalkanes without a transition-metal catalyst
An efficient carbon-sulfur bond formation reaction has been developed under microwave irradiation. This reaction affords a novel and rapid synthesis of thioacetals and sulfides under mild conditions.
